Can militias make a difference on the battlefield in Afghanistan? 

For years, the Afghan government worked to disband and disarm warlords and their militias. Now, it’s doing a 180. Afghan officials are rushing to revive ties with militias and get their help fighting the Taliban. Can it work? The World’s Shirin Jaafari reports from Herat.
